PACD Awards over $100,000 for Conservation District Education Projects

For over 20 years, the PACD has secured grants to help support the educational efforts of county conservation districts. For instance, with funding provided by the PA Chesapeake Bay Program and the EPA Section 319 Program, PACD administers two Educational Mini-grant Programs. The programs provide conservation districts with up to $2,500 for Chesapeake Bay or general Nonpoint Source Pollution (NPS) educational activities.

In June, PACD awarded over $100,000 for fifty-four conservation district education projects. The projects address a variety of topics including agriculture, community conservation, stormwater management, and watershed education. Fran Koch and Cedric Karper, from the Pennsylvania Department of Environmental Protection (DEP), are strong advocates of the mini-grant programs.

"The mini-grants provide necessary funds to create an event, to share ideas, check out BMPs, or effectively communicate innovative nonpoint source (NPs) pollution solutions. Posting the mini-grant products on PACD's website also facilitates the transfer of information garnered from the mini-grants and enables others to customize the products for use in their county. The mini-grants are an efficient, effective method to support the local grassroots ideas for outreach and education on NPs pollution solutions," said Fran Koch, Chief of the NPs Implementation Unit, DEP.

"Interest in the mini-grant program remains high. The projects funded through these grants are important to support outreach and education activities in the Bay Program. Mini-grants represent small investments that can make a big difference in conservation practices and environmental protection," said Cedric Karper, Chief, Division of Conservation Districts and Nutrient Management, DEP.

Once mini-grant projects are completed, PACD posts the final products of many on its website. Other districts may then adapt these publications or presentations for use in their own counties. This past year's projects were amazing for the depth of content, utility, and professional quality.
